Impaired mitochondrial function in bipolar disorder and alcohol use disorder: a case study using F-BCPP-EF PET imaging of mitochondrial Complex I.

Abstract

BACKGROUND

With bipolar disorder (BD) having a lifetime prevalence of 4.4% and a significant portion of patients being chronically burdened by symptoms, there has been an increased focus on uncovering new targets for intervention in BD. One area that has shown early promise is the mitochondrial hypothesis. However, at the time of publication no studies have utilized positron emission tomography (PET) imaging to assess mitochondrial function in the setting of BD.

CASE PRESENTATION

Our participant is a 58 year-old male with a past medical history notable for alcohol use disorder and BD (unspecified type) who underwent PET imaging with the mitochondrial complex I PET ligand F-BCPP-EF. The resulting images demonstrated significant overlap between areas of dysfunction identified with the F-BCPP-EF PET ligand and prior functional magnetic resonance imaging (MRI) techniques in the setting of BD. That overlap was seen in both affective and cognitive circuits, with mitochondrial dysfunction in the fronto-limbic, ventral affective, and dorsal cognitive circuits showing particularly significant differences.

CONCLUSIONS

Despite mounting evidence implicating mitochondria in BD, this study represents the first PET imaging study to investigate this mechanistic connection. There were key limitations in the form of comorbid alcohol use disorder, limited statistical power inherent to a case study, no sex matched controls, and the absence of a comprehensive psychiatric history. However, even with these limitations in mind, the significant overlap between dysfunction previously demonstrated on functional MRI and this imaging provides compelling preliminary evidence that strengthens the mechanistic link between mitochondrial dysfunction and BD.

摘要

背景

双相情感障碍(BD)的终生患病率为4.4%,且很大一部分患者长期受症状困扰,因此人们越来越关注寻找BD的新干预靶点。线粒体假说这一领域已显示出早期前景。然而,在本文发表时,尚无研究利用正电子发射断层扫描(PET)成像来评估BD患者的线粒体功能。

病例介绍

我们的参与者是一名58岁男性,有酒精使用障碍和BD(未明确类型)病史,他接受了使用线粒体复合体I PET配体F-BCPP-EF的PET成像。所得图像显示,在BD患者中,F-BCPP-EF PET配体识别出的功能障碍区域与先前的功能磁共振成像(MRI)技术所识别的区域有显著重叠。这种重叠在情感和认知回路中均可见,前额叶边缘、腹侧情感和背侧认知回路中的线粒体功能障碍表现出尤为显著的差异。

结论

尽管越来越多的证据表明线粒体与BD有关,但本研究是首个调查这种机制联系的PET成像研究。本研究存在一些关键局限性,包括合并酒精使用障碍、病例研究固有的统计效力有限、缺乏性别匹配的对照以及没有全面的精神病史。然而,即便考虑到这些局限性,先前功能MRI显示的功能障碍与本成像之间的显著重叠提供了有力的初步证据,强化了线粒体功能障碍与BD之间的机制联系。
